Carlisle High School is a public high school located in Carlisle, Pennsylvania, United States.It serves grades 9–12 for the Carlisle Area School District.. The district includes Carlisle and Mount Holly Springs boroughs (the latter being an exclave of the school district), and the townships of and Dickinson and North Middleton.

Carlisle Area School District encompasses approximately 75 square miles (190 km 2). According to 2000 federal census data, it serves a resident population of 34,794. in 2009, the residents' per capita income was $22,214, while the districts' median family income was $52,276.
Three schools, Carlisle High School (9-12), Carlisle Middle School (6-8), and Carlisle Elementary School (PreK-3) are within the city limits. The high school, the lower elementary school, and the district headquarters are adjacent to one another. Hartford Upper Elementary School (4-5) is not within the City of Carlisle. The live streaming of video games is an activity where people broadcast themselves playing games to a live audience online. [1] The practice became popular in the mid-2010s on the US-based site Twitch, before growing to YouTube, Facebook, China-based sites Huya Live, DouYu, and Bilibili, and other services.
